One mother project to boost trout fish production in J

Srinagar, Aug 5 (UNI) To give a big boost to trout fish production in the state, a mother project had been set up in south Kashmir where eight lakh of fry of trout are being produced for catering to the need of various rearing units in the Jammu and Kashmir.

Director Fisheries, T Angchook said, two National Fish Seed Farms, one at Kathua and another at Mansbal in Kashmir valley are already working.

The quality seed of carps like Indian Major Carps are produced in these farms.

To give a further boost to trout fish, the department had set up one mother project at Kokernag where, with other minor hatcheries, produced 18 lakh of fry of trout for catering to the need of various rearing units in the state.

The department had sold out 60 tons of trout to the common man till date.

He said under Prime Minister's package the department had set up 395 units in the private sector for employment of the unemployed rural youth.

The department intended to set up 100 units during the current financial year, he added.
